
Kings Bridge Bar and Restaurant
Situated in a building originally constructed in 1840 sixty one kilometres from Launceston and moved to its current location on Paterson Street in 1972, Kings Bridge Bar & Restaurant is a classic pub with a classy twist. Enjoy all your usual pub meal favourites here (we highly recommend the Parmi), along with breakfast, lunch, dinner, dessert and kids menus; and even bottomless brunch and bar snacks.
Kings Bridge also serves an extensive range of wines, beers, ciders, cocktails and spirits; and hosts weekly live music sessions.
